A Hauling Contract in Phoenix is a legal document that formalizes an agreement between a city and a waste management company for the provision of waste hauling services. This contract specifies the terms and conditions under which the waste management company will operate, including service frequency, types of waste collected, and compensation details. Key features involve stipulations for regulatory compliance, service guidelines, and provisions for adjustments in payment based on the Consumer Price Index. The document outlines the responsibilities of both parties, including indemnity and insurance requirements, and includes terms for contract amendment and breach notification. Trucking contracts are legally binding agreements between trucking carriers and their shippers that outline the terms and conditions of transportation services. These contracts establish the rights, obligations, and responsibilities of both parties involved in the shipping and delivering of goods or freight.

Common carrier means a person holding itself out to the general public to provide transportation for compensation. Contract carrier means a person providing transportation for compensation under continuing agreements with one person or a limited number of persons.
